How to Fix server DNS address could not be found error on Google Chrome

Windows 8, 8.1 and 10 users may sometimes be unable to access some websites on their web browsers. When accessing some websites, the user may be presented with the messages ‘site’s server DNS address cannot be found’. This won’t happen for every website, but those affected may seem random in nature

In this guide, we are going to look at user-supported solutions to this problem occuring on Google Chrome.

Method 1: Clear Host Cache

You can also clear your Host cache, which will solve the problem if it is being caused by an Extension. To clear out your cache, enter Incognito Mode in Chrome by pressing the three vertical dots in the top right of the page, and clicking ‘New Incognito Window’.

In the URL bar, enter chrome://net-internals/#dns and press Enter on your keyboard. On the screen, look for the Clear Host Cache button. Next, open up a command window by finding by pressing Start and choosing Run. In the text field, type ‘cmd’ and then enter ipconfig /flushdns.

Method 2: Update the DNS

This method has gained a lot of popularity which suggests that the user should update the DNS server to that of Google as they are more reliable. If Method 1 fails, try the DNS_PROBE_FINISHED_NXDOMAIN solution.
